Aims of the Programme

The programme aims to provide a thorough understanding of all aspects of human anatomy. It is targeted mainly at those from overseas, especially the Indian subcontinent, who for professional reasons are required to undertake a higher degree in Anatomy prior to taking up an Anatomy teaching appointment. It is also open to individuals from the UK, EU and other countries.

Programme Content

The programme will cover all aspects of human anatomy, including gross anatomy through whole body dissection, human embryology, neuroanatomy, histology and cell biology. There will also be an introduction to anatomical variation and clinical/surgical anatomy. Each student also completes a dissertation or small project.

This programme is also available part-time over 24 months (to Home/EU students only.)

Methods of Assessment

Written and practical examinations; essays; seminars; presentations; dissertation/thesis.

Entry Requirements

First degree in a Life Sciences, Medicine or Dentistry, or related subject. Minimum equivalent to upper second class honours.

English Language Requirement: IELTS of 6.5 (or equivalent), if your first language is not English. Please check our Language Requirements page for details of equivalent grades from other test providers, and information about the University of Dundee English Language courses.
